BAA Training launches new pilot training programme in cooperation with ENAC

BAA Training launches a new ab initio training programme in cooperation with Ecole Nationale de l’Aviation Civile (ENAC). The new pilot training programme has been tailored to individual, self-sponsored clients so that anyone interested, with little or no aviation experience, can enrol. BAA Training will deliver ATPL theoretical phase, VFR and advanced phases in accordance with the customer’s demands. Bridge VFR and IFR will be subcontracted to ENAC and conducted in one of its training centres in France.

Marijus Ravoitis, CEO at BAA Training: “We have been partners with ENAC for over two years now. As both organisations share a common mission in the industry, we are glad to pool our expertise to offer world-class training to everyone willing to become commercial pilots. The new programme for individual students that we have now launched in cooperation with ENAC is the next step after we introduced the same kind of programme to airlines.”

“We predict the programme, based on ENAC’s and BAA Training best training practices, will receive the most attention from customers who are interested in spending part of their training in the French environment. ENAC is our partner in this region and is recognised for its high standards in aviation training,” Ravoitis added.
